PROCEDURE
实验过程
Combine (R)-4-chloro-5-methyl-5,6-dihydropyrido[2,3-d]pyrimidin-7(8H)-one (15.69 g, 1.2 eq), triethylamine (10.14 mL, 1.1 eq), 4-[1-(2-pyrrolidin-1-yl-ethyl)-4-(tetrahydro-pyran-4-yl)-1H-imidazol-2-yl]-piperidine (22 g, 66.17 mmol) and N-methylpyrrolidinone (66 mL). Stir at 110° C. for 16 hours, then allow to cool to room temperature. Dilute with ethyl acetate (110 mL) and water (220 mL). Add 5 M aqueous sodium hydroxide to adjust the pH to 12. Extract with ethyl acetate (2×200 mL). Wash the organics with saturated aqueous sodium chloride. Add water (220 mL) to the organics and aqueous 85% phosphoric acid to adjust the pH to 3. Wash the resulting acidic aqueous layer with ethyl acetate (2×100 mL). Add 5 M aqueous sodium hydroxide to adjust the pH to 12. Extract with ethyl acetate (3×70 mL). Wash the organics with saturated aqueous sodium chloride (50 mL). Dry the organics over anhydrous magnesium sulfate and concentrate in vacuo to give the final compound as a light brown solid (21.5 g, 64%). MS (ES) m/z=494 [M]+.
